Shell Convent Refinery. Shell Convent Refinery is located next to the Mississippi River, midway between Baton Rouge and New Orleans. The refinery is designed to process approximately 240,000 barrels per day of crude oil, producing conventional petroleum products and refinery grade sulfur. The refinery is located on a 4,400-acre tract of land ...

More than 190,000 miles of liquid petroleum pipelines traverse the United States. They connect producing areas to refineries and chemical plants while delivering the products American consumers and businesses need. Pipelines are safe, efficient and, because most are buried, largely unseen. All refineries have three basic steps: Separation. Conversion. Treatment.Washington state has the fifth highest oil refining capacity of any state. As of 2018, there are 5 refineries in Washington state with a joint capacity of 637,700 b/d. The United States petroleum refining industry, the world’s largest, is most heavily concentrated along the Gulf Coast of Texas and Louisiana. In 2012, US refiners produced 18.5 million barrels per day of refined petroleum products. As of January 1, 2021, there were 129 operable petroleum refineries in the United States.
